Several Providence Recruits Among 57 Invited to USA Basketball Junior National Team Minicamp
USA Basketball has become a big part of Providence’s basketball program because head coach Ed Cooley has taken on growing responsibilities with the organization over the last few years. In the summer of 2013 Cooley was a court coach during training camp in Colorado Springs. In 2014 Cooley was named as an assistant coach on Billy Donovan’s staff for the U18 USA National Team that participated and won gold at the 2014 FIBA Americas U18 Championship. After Donovan took the head coaching job with the Oklahoma City Thunder Cooley’s fellow assistant on Donovan’s U18 staff Sean Miller was promoted to head coach of the U19 team and Cooley remained as Miller’s assistant for the 2015 FIBA U19 World Championship. That squad also brought home the gold from Crete, Greece.

Report: Sean Miller To Take Reigns of U19 USA National Team, Ed Cooley to Stay on Staff
One domino that may not have been immediately considered by some was that Billy Donovan taking the head coaching job with the Oklahoma City Thunder of the NBA meant that Donovan could no longer coach the U19 USA National team this summer. Ed Cooley and Sean Miller were named as Donovan’s assistants in January 2015. They both served on Donovan’s staff for the U18 USA National team last summer.

Ed Cooley to be Assistant on Billy Donovan’s Staff of USA U19 Team
After a successful campaign at the FIBA Americas U18 Championship that saw Team USA dominate the competition and finish 5-0 to get the gold medal last summer, USA Basketball announced on Tuesday that University of Florida head coach Billy Donovan and his entire coaching staff would return to coach the U19 team for the 2015 U19 World Championships. That means Providence head coach Ed Cooley and Arizona head coach Sean Miller will again join Donovan on the Team USA coaching staff.
